Documentation
Definition
This indicator is used to determine whether passwords are to be case-sensitive. If the indicator is set (X), the password is evaluated exactly as it is entered; if the indicator is not set ( ), the system converts the password to upper-case internally and does not take account of upper- and lower-case in comparisons.
